Three years ago I sent 12 boxes. I even had a postal truck come to pick up the stuff from my apartment, for free. Taiwan post office is great (just don't do any banking with them). I got large boxes in excellent condition for $10 per piece from a fruit shop (you can probably get them for free from places like Wellcome if you go there at the time when deliveries are made).
